The Silent Patient by Alex Michaelides [Review]

The Silent Patient by Alex Michaelides is a psychological thriller that will keep you on the edge of your seat. This gripping novel tells the story of Alicia Berenson, an artist who shoots and kills her husband in cold blood. She refuses to speak about it or offer any explanation for her actions, which makes her a silent patient at the Grove psychiatric hospital. The book follows Theo Faber, a psychotherapist determined to unlock Alicia’s secrets and uncover why she committed this heinous crime. With its dark atmosphere and intense exploration of human psychology, The Silent Patient is sure to captivate readers with its thrilling narrative and unforgettable characters. Readers can expect twists and turns around every corner as they unravel the mystery of Alicia’s past and try to figure out what led her to such an extreme act. In addition, The Silent Patient also includes relevant topics such as mental health, family dynamics, and the power of art. Through these themes, Alex Michaelides successfully brings the story to life in an engaging way that will leave readers wanting more.
